一种用于高速公路的快速有效的车道线识别算法

摘    要:提出了一种针对高速公路的车道线检测与跟踪方法;在图像预处理中采用基于采样的自适应阈值以满足不同光照条件下的使用要求,采用霍夫变换(HT,Hough Transform)进行车道线初始检测,车道线跟踪利用Kalman预测参数动态建立感兴趣区域(ROI,Region of Interest),用扫描线法搜索车道线边界点,在车道线间断区域利用Kalman预测器定位车道线边界;设计了一个失效判别模块,验证跟踪结果,当跟踪失败时,重新启动初始检测算法进行识别;实验结果表明,对于不同的车道线种类和在大部分车道线被前方车辆遮挡的条件下,该算法均具有较高的实时性和鲁棒性。

A Fast and Efficient Lane Recognition Algorithm for Highway

Abstract:A method of lane detection and tracking for highway is proposed.The adaptive threshold based on sampling was used for different illumination demands during image pretreatment.Lane was initially detected by Hough Transform.In lane tracking,the region of interest(ROI) was established with parameters predicted through the Kalman predictor,the lane boundary points were searched by scanning line method in ROI,and the lane boundary in discontinuous area was located by Kalman predictor.A judgment module that was responsible for estimating tracking results was introduced.If tracking algorithm was disabled,initial detection algorithm was restarted.For various kinds of lanes and most lanes covered with vehicles ahead,experiment results indicate that the algorithm has good robustness and efficiency.
